Ingredients List

Ingredient Amount Substitution Options
Whole wheat tortillas 4 large Flour tortillas or gluten-free tortillas
Feta cheese 1 cup, crumbled Goat cheese or ricotta
Spinach 2 cups, fresh Arugula or kale
Red onion 1 medium, thinly sliced Shallots or scallions
Olives ½ cup, pitted and sliced Capers or sun-dried tomatoes
Cherry tomatoes 1 cup, halved Regular tomatoes or roasted red peppers
Olive oil 2 tablespoons Avocado oil or melted butter
Oregano 1 teaspoon, dried Italian seasoning or thyme
Pepper To taste Black pepper or cayenne pepper
Lemon juice 1 tablespoon Vinegar or lime juice

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Sauté the Vegetables

Begin by heating 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the sliced red onion and cook until tender, about 3 to 4 minutes. Then, toss in the fresh spinach and sauté until wilted. This process enhances the flavors and creates a beautiful aroma in your kitchen.

Step 2: Combine the Filling Ingredients

In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ooked onions and spinach with feta cheese, olives, cherry tomatoes, oregano, pepper, and lemon juice. Mix gently to combine all ingredients, allowing the flavors to meld together. Your filling will be robust and colorful, embodying the essence of Greek cuisine.

Step 3: Assemble the Quesadillas

Take one tortilla and place a generous portion of the filling on one half of the tortilla. Fold it over to create a half-moon shape. Repeat this for the remaining tortillas. Make sure not to overfill them, as this will make flipping difficult!

Step 4: Cook the Quesadillas

Heat the remaining tablespoon of olive oil in the same skillet over medium-high heat. Place the quesadillas in the skillet one or two at a time (depending on your skillet size). Cook for about 3-4 minutes on each side, or until golden brown and crisp. You want that perfect, crispy exterior that contrasts delightfully with the rich, melted filling inside!

Step 5: Serve and Enjoy

Once cooked, transfer the quesadillas to a cutting board and let them rest for a minute before slicing into wedges. Serve with a drizzle of yogurt or tzatziki sauce for an added burst of flavor. Enjoy your Greek quesadillas warm alongside a simple salad or your favorite sides!

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Overfilling the Tortillas: This can cause your quesadillas to burst, making them messy. Stick to a generous but manageable amount of filling.
  • Using High Heat: Cooking over high heat may lead to burnt tortillas while the filling remains cold. Maintain medium heat for optimal results.
  • Not Allowing Rest Time: Letting cooked quesadillas rest for a minute helps the filling set, making them easier to slice and serve.

Storing Tips for the Recipe

If you have leftovers, storing them properly can help maintain their taste and texture:

  • In the Fridge: Store cooked quesadillas in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Layer parchment paper between quesadillas to prevent sticking.
  • In the Freezer: Place quesadillas separated by wax paper and wrap them tightly in aluminum foil to freeze for up to 2 months.
  • Reheating: Reheat on a skillet over low heat for the best texture, or heat in a microwave with a damp paper towel to maintain moisture.
